Dell Vostro V13 out there at $450
December 10th, 2009
Nicely priced at $450, Dell have just unleashed the super thin Vostro V13 laptop. The unit measures 19.7mm at its highest point but despite this minimal dimension it still boasts a good set of ports and slots. Here are the rest of specifications for the Vostro V13 laptop
* Intel® Celeron® M Processor ULV 743 (1M Cache, 1.30 GHz, 800 MHz FSB)
* Ubuntu Linux version 9.04
* 2.0GB, DDR3-1066MHz SDRAM, 1 DIMM
* 250GB 5400RPM SATA Hard Drive
* Mobile Intel Graphics Media Accelerator 4500MHD
* 1.3MP Webcam with Digital Microphone
* Dell Wireless 1397 802.11b/g
* 6-cell 30WHr Internal Battery
* 13.3-inch diagonal LED-backlit HD (1366 x 768) Anti-glare
* Bluetooth 2.1
* Gigabit Ethernet (10/100/1000 NIC)
* Network connector (RJ45), USB 2.0 (1), USB 2.0/eSATA combo (1), Microphone jack, Headphone/speaker out, 5-in-1 card reader, 34 mm ExpressCard
* 13 x 0.78 x 9.06 inches
* 3.5lbs
In case you’re a Windows fan, an extra $150 will get you Windows 7 Home Premium rather than Ubuntu plus a faster processor and slightly larger HDD.
